হিসাব নিকাশ POS সফটওয়্যার এ কিভাবে এসএমএস সেটিং ঠিক করবেন

 
 
আপনার POS সফটওয়্যার থেকে স্বয়ংক্রিয়ভাবে SMS পাঠান: SMS Gateway ইন্টিগ্রেশন গাইড

বর্তমান ব্যবসায়িক প্রেক্ষাপটে গ্রাহকদের সাথে দ্রুত ও কার্যকর যোগাযোগ স্থাপন করা অত্যন্ত গুরুত্বপূর্ণ। আপনার পয়েন্ট অফ সেল (POS) সফটওয়্যার থেকে সরাসরি স্বয়ংক্রিয়ভাবে অর্ডার কনফার্মেশন, বিলের তথ্য, বকেয়া বিলের রিমাইন্ডার বা বিশেষ অফারের বার্তা পাঠাতে পারলে গ্রাহক সন্তুষ্টি যেমন বাড়ে, তেমনি আপনার ব্যবসাও অনেক বেশি পেশাদার হয়ে ওঠে।

আজ আমরা দেখাবো কীভাবে আপনি যেকোনো POS সফটওয়্যারে একটি কাস্টম SMS Gateway যুক্ত করতে পারেন। এই গাইডে আমরা একটি বহুল ব্যবহৃত SMS সার্ভিস প্রোভাইডার (Bulk SMS BD) এর উদাহরণ ব্যবহার করব, তবে এই নিয়মাবলী প্রায় সব ধরনের SMS গেটওয়ের জন্য প্রযোজ্য।

শুরুর আগে আপনার যা যা প্রয়োজন হবে:

১. একটি POS সফটওয়্যার, যেখানে কাস্টম SMS Gateway যুক্ত করার অপশন রয়েছে। ২. যেকোনো SMS সার্ভিস প্রোভাইডারের একটি সক্রিয় অ্যাকাউন্ট। ৩. আপনার SMS প্রোভাইডারের দেওয়া API Key, Sender ID এবং API URL

API তথ্যগুলো কোথায় পাবেন? আপনি যে SMS সার্ভিস প্রোভাইডার ব্যবহার করেন (যেমন: Bulk SMS BD), তাদের ওয়েবসাইটে আপনার অ্যাকাউন্টে লগইন করুন। সাধারণত “Developer Option”, “API Documentation” বা “API Info” নামে একটি সেকশন থাকে। সেখানেই আপনি আপনার ব্যক্তিগত API Key এবং অনুমোদিত Sender ID পেয়ে যাবেন।


চলুন শুরু করা যাক: ধাপে ধাপে ইন্টিগ্রেশন প্রক্রিয়া

আপনার POS সফটওয়্যারের SMS সেটিংস সেকশনে যান। সেখানে আপনি নিচের মতো কিছু ফিল্ড দেখতে পাবেন। আমরা দেখাবো কোন ফিল্ডে কী তথ্য পূরণ করতে হবে।

ধাপ ১: সাধারণ কনফিগারেশন

এই অংশে আমরা মূল সংযোগের তথ্যগুলো সেট করব।

  • SMS Service: এখানে Nexmo বা Twilio এর মতো অপশন থাকলে, আপনি Other অথবা Custom নির্বাচন করুন।

  • Request Method: GET নির্বাচন করুন। বেশিরভাগ সহজ API এই মেথড সমর্থন করে।

  • URL: এখানে আপনার SMS প্রোভাইডারের দেওয়া মূল API URL টি বসান। খেয়াল রাখবেন, এখানে শুধু URL-এর মূল অংশটি বসবে, কোনো প্যারামিটার (প্রশ্নবোধক চিহ্নের ? পরের অংশ) ছাড়া।

    • উদাহরণ: http://bulksmsbd.net/api/smsapi

ধাপ ২: ডাইনামিক প্যারামিটার সেট করা

ডাইনামিক প্যারামিটার হলো সেই অংশ যা প্রতিটি SMS পাঠানোর সময় পরিবর্তিত হয়, যেমন গ্রাহকের মোবাইল নম্বর এবং মেসেজের বিষয়বস্তু।

  • Send to parameter name: এখানে SMS API তে মোবাইল নম্বর পাঠানোর জন্য যে প্যারামিটার ব্যবহৃত হয়, তার নাম লিখুন।

    • উদাহরণ: number

  • Message parameter name: একইভাবে, মেসেজ পাঠানোর জন্য ব্যবহৃত প্যারামিটারের নামটি এখানে লিখুন।

    • উদাহরণ: message

ধাপ ৩: স্ট্যাটিক প্যারামিটার যুক্ত করা

স্ট্যাটিক প্যারামিটার হলো সেই তথ্য যা প্রতিটি SMS পাঠানোর সময় অপরিবর্তিত থাকে, যেমন আপনার API Key এবং Sender ID।

  • Parameter 1 key: api_key

  • Parameter 1 value: [আপনার API Key এখানে বসান]

  • Parameter 2 key: senderid

  • Parameter 2 value: [আপনার Sender ID এখানে বসান]

  • Parameter 3 key: type

  • Parameter 3 value: text (কারণ আমরা টেক্সট মেসেজ পাঠাচ্ছি)

  • Header Settings: যদি আপনার POS সফটওয়্যারে Header সম্পর্কিত কোনো ফিল্ড থাকে, তবে সেগুলো খালি রাখুন, কারণ আমাদের এই API-এর জন্য কোনো হেডারের প্রয়োজন নেই।


একনজরে সম্পূর্ণ সেটিংস:

ফিল্ডের নামআপনার করণীয়
SMS ServiceOther নির্বাচন করুন
URLhttp://bulksmsbd.net/api/smsapi
Send to parameter namenumber
Message parameter namemessage
Request MethodGET
Parameter 1 key/valueapi_key / [আপনার API Key এখানে বসান]
Parameter 2 key/valuesenderid / [আপনার Sender ID এখানে বসান]
Parameter 3 key/valuetype / text

শেষ কথা ও টেস্টিং

উপরের সব তথ্য সঠিকভাবে পূরণ করার পর সেটিংস Save করুন।

সবকিছু ঠিকঠাক আছে কিনা তা যাচাই করার জন্য, আপনার নিজের মোবাইল নম্বরে একটি পরীক্ষামূলক SMS পাঠান। যদি মেসেজটি সফলভাবে আপনার ফোনে চলে আসে, তাহলে অভিনন্দন! আপনি সফলভাবে আপনার POS সফটওয়্যারের সাথে SMS Gateway যুক্ত করেছেন। এখন থেকে আপনার গ্রাহকদের কাছে সকল প্রয়োজনীয় বার্তা পৌঁছে যাবে স্বয়ংক্রিয়ভাবে, যা আপনার ব্যবসার উন্নতিতে সহায়তা করবে।

যদি কোনো সমস্যা হয়, তবে আপনার API Key, Sender ID এবং প্যারামিটারের নামগুলো পুনরায় আপনার SMS প্রোভাইডারের ড্যাশবোর্ডের সাথে মিলিয়ে দেখুন। শুভকামনা!